Baby unicorn magicPumpkin Cake using magic.The episode Baby Cakes features a little baby unicorn named Pumpkin Cake, the daughter of Mr. and Mrs. Cake, who uses her magic unexpectedly when Pinkie babysits her and her Pegasus twin brother,Pound Cake. Rarity cautions the other ponies at the beginning of the episode that "baby unicorns get strange magic surges that come and go", and Pumpkin Cake experiences these surges when she's able to use her magic to teleport, walk through solid objects, levitate herself and other objects, and break the locks and chains that Pinkie put around the toy chest. Gordon Freeman 85 January 15, 2014 Share January 15, 2014 (edited) Considering that they are both earth ponies that have a mixed background down the line, think of it as the recessive genes that exist in our world; they were carriers of the genetic traits that belong to pegasi and unicorns (although distantly), and were just the extremely off-hand chance of having no earth pony children. I guess as long as one of the pegasi had earth pony ancestry, yes that sounds possible, however, they would not be able to walk on clouds, as already mentioned, and would probably end up with the parents just moving to some other grounded residence and flying to their jobs, should they move somewhere close enough; pretty much a normal life on both sides, although the child may have some identity issues because of it.
